Hydroxyethylcellulose LotionsHydroxyethylcellulose is a non ionic, water soluble cellulose derivative used in cosmetic and personal care formulations as a rheology modifier, thickener, and stabilizer. This specific grade (QP 4400 H) offers high viscosity and excellent salt tolerance, making it especially well suited for surfactant systems, clear gels, shampoos, body washes, and lotions.
